Effect of rapamycin on Cryptococcus neoformans : cellular organization, biophysics and virulence factors.

Future microbiology(2023)

Cited 0|Views7
No score
Abstract
is an opportunistic fungal pathogen that causes infections mainly in immunosuppressed individuals, such as transplant recipients. This study investigated the effects of rapamycin, an immunosuppressant drug, on the cellular organization, biophysical characteristics, and main virulence factors of . Morphological, structural, physicochemical and biophysical analyses of cells and secreted polysaccharides of the reference H99 strain were investigated under the effect of subinhibitory concentrations of rapamycin. Rapamycin at a minimum inhibitory concentration of 2.5 μM reduced cell viability by 53%, decreased capsule, increased cell size, chitin and lipid body formation, and changed peptidase and urease activity.
